Can Someone Hack My Binance Account? Understanding the Risks and How to Protect Yourself

In the rapidly evolving world of cryptocurrency, Binance has emerged as one of the leading exchanges, attracting millions of users worldwide. However, with the increasing popularity of digital currencies, the risk of account hacking has also grown. Many users wonder, "Can someone hack my Binance account?" This article aims to shed light on the risks associated with Binance account hacking and provide practical tips to help you protect your account.
Can someone hack my Binance account? The answer is yes, it is possible. Cybercriminals are constantly evolving their techniques to gain unauthorized access to user accounts. Here are some common methods they use:
1. Phishing: Cybercriminals send fraudulent emails or messages that appear to be from Binance, tricking users into providing their login credentials. Once they have access to your account, they can steal your funds.
2. Malware: Malicious software, such as keyloggers or spyware, can be installed on your device without your knowledge. This software can capture your keystrokes and steal your login information.
3. Social engineering: Cybercriminals may use social engineering techniques to manipulate you into revealing your account details. They may pretend to be Binance support staff and ask for your login credentials.
4. Weak passwords: If your Binance account password is weak or easily guessable, it becomes easier for hackers to gain access to your account.
To protect your Binance account from hacking, follow these best practices:
1. Use a strong, unique password: Create a password that is long, complex, and includes a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ters. Avoid using common words or phrases that can be easily guessed.
2. Enable two-factor authentication (2FA): 2FA adds an extra layer of security to your account by requiring a second form of verification, such as a code sent to your phone, before you can log in.
3. Keep your software updated: Regularly update your operating system, web browser, and antivirus software to protect against vulnerabilities that hackers can exploit.
4. Be cautious of phishing attempts: Never click on suspicious links or provide your login credentials in response to unsolicited emails or messages.
5. Use a secure Wi-Fi connection: Avoid logging into your Binance account on public Wi-Fi networks, as these are often unsecured and can be easily intercepted by hackers.
6. Monitor your account activity: Regularly check your Binance account for any unusual transactions or login attempts. If you notice anything suspicious, report it immediately to Binance support.
7. Use a hardware wallet: For maximum security, consider storing your cryptocurrencies in a hardware wallet. These wallets are offline and offer a high level of protection against hacking.
In conclusion, the answer to "Can someone hack my Binance account?" is yes, but there are steps you can take to minimize the risk. By following the best practices outlined in this article, you can help ensure that your Binance account remains secure and your funds protected. Stay vigilant and stay informed about the latest cybersecurity threats to keep your account safe from hackers.
